Cheshire West and Chester Council company Vivo Care Choices has helped the brand-new West Cheshire Autism Hub get ready for its virtual launch.
The Autism Hub will be a welcoming space for autistic people to visit and access services, such as post-diagnostic support, supported volunteering and internship opportunities, social and community group activities and much more.
Organisations from across west Cheshire that deliver autism services are involved in the project, which is supported by the likes of the Council, NHS Cheshire Clinical Commissioning Group (CCG) and Cheshire and Wirral Partnership NHS Foundation Trust.
While the Autism Hub will eventually be based at The Bluecoat in Chester, it has had to launch virtually for the time being because of the coronavirus (COVID-19) pandemic.
Vivo has been working closely with the Autism Hub in the background to get The Bluecoat ready, bring partners on board and develop a unique brand for the project.
